Curtin vs Phillip
The verdict
Phillip rates higher for transport (57 vs 49). Phillip is closer to the coast (106.3 km vs 108.3 km). On the separate residential safety score, Curtin rates higher (97 vs 24/100 in Phillip).

Demographics
| Curtin | Phillip |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 5,569 | 5,197 |
| Median age | 41 | 32 |
| Median household income (wk) | $2,886 | $2,075 |
| Bachelor degree or higher | 71.1% | 69.0% |
| Born in Australia | 73.4% | 52.2% |
| Avg household size | 2.6 | 1.9 |

Safety
| Curtin | Phillip | |
|---|---|---|
| Residential safety score | 97 | 24 |
| Break & enter dwelling /100k | 72 | 192 |
| Motor vehicle theft /100k | 198 | 731 |
| Domestic assault /100k | 54 | 750 |
| Total incidents /100k (all) | 1,365 | 15,509 |
